Output d26dff7ced87ff97bb1320fc07e532d5ff642702cc68e40d695d07ef1ea75fa8:0

value
55829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c8b2c3fb5afebbcbb7fef699a484b458605cc2 OP_EQUAL
address
3PBj9PNJVBeqqv7NKvg8B6YizhPVhsL5TK
transaction
d26dff7ced87ff97bb1320fc07e532d5ff642702cc68e40d695d07ef1ea75fa8
confirmations
531906
spent
true